系统 数据库 中间件 CAE 杀毒 防火墙 入侵检测 VPN 加密 ERP 财务管理 进销存 物流 协同办公OA 桌面办公 网络管理 CAD GIS

英特尔 线程检查器 3.0 Linux 版 单个开发人员 续订一年

简介:
立刻采用多线程技术,释放多核处理器(包括最新的 64 位四核处理器)系统的卓越性能。英特尔? 线程检查器 3.1 Linux* 版通过检测诸如数据竞跑和死锁等难以发现的线程错误,可杜绝错误发生,从而加速线程应用的开发。

报价:400 元
产品说明
产品图片
4 产品参数
编  码   品 牌 英特尔  购买方式 服务 
版本类型 版本号 3.0 语言版本 英文版
软件环境 见正文
硬件环境 见正文
4 相关下载
4 产品认证获奖情况
4 产品应用案例
4 产品描述

概述
立刻采用多线程技术,释放多核处理器(包括最新的 64 位四核处理器)系统的卓越性能。
英特尔? 线程检查器 3.1 Linux* 版通过检测诸如数据竞跑和死锁等难以发现的线程错误,可杜绝错误发生,从而加速线程应用的开发。
特性
通过命令行界面,英特尔? 线程检查器 3.1 Linux 版可帮助您正确地对应用进行线程处理。它可降低添加线程所造成的风险,并为您提供实践学习的机会。您还可利用它在开发的早期阶段快速发现设计问题,或可将其集成到测试系统中以排除错误。
已获专利的高级检错引擎
查找可能发生的潜在错误(如死锁和数据竞跑),将这些错误映射至内存参数和源代码行。
发现六个级别(从错误和警告到信息提示)的线程问题。
显示所有必要警告,以便有效为线程应用进行诊断。
对于英特尔? 编译器生成的应用,如果针对源代码配置进行编译,则可将潜在错误跟踪至源代码行中的变量。
您可以使用标准调试来构建应用,而无需重新编译整个源代码库。
如图 1 所示,英特尔? 线程检查器 Linux 版能够发现所有潜在线程错误或可能发生的线程错误,例如数据竞跑和死锁,并显示哪些源代码需要修改才能更正线程问题。英特尔? 线程检查器可以帮助您在应用中利用多核技术。


图 1. 查看您需要对源代码进行哪些改动,以更正线程问题
在源代码中执行更改后,可以重新运行英特尔? 线程检查器,以跟踪导致潜在线程错误减少的更改。在图 2 中,源代码修正减少了线程错误,对于应用纠错而言,这比告警或信息提示更为重要。


图 2. 英特尔? 线程检查器可用于修改代码,以便对应用进行修复
本地 Linux 支持:
在本地 Linux 环境下工作,无需使用远程 Windows 系统。
熟悉的命令行界面。
可轻松集成在批处理脚本中,以便用于夜间运行的回归测试。
支持最新多核处理器:
迅速将零错误线程化软件投放市场,为英特尔最新多核处理器上的开发提供有利的竞争优势。
通过高质量的线程代码库,为以后的处理器准备大量执行内核。
英特尔? 64 架构支持:
在采用英特尔 64 位架构处理器上的 64 位和 32 位应用中,可配置源代码和二进制指令,并在开发生命周期的不同阶段实现灵活地配置。
为 64 位和 32 位平台提供完全一致的功能,开发人员也可获得同样的用户体验。两个平台具有通用的环境,可以提高开发效率。
命令行界面:
使用可编写脚本的接口,轻松地将英特尔线程检查器集成至您的测试环境。
以批处理模式进行自动测试;减少手动配置,提高效率。
这简化了每日回归测试的配置过程,提高了开发效率。
可选的配置:
通过可选择的 DLL 配置,降低了配置时间。
根据程序库对性能的影响为其链接辅助工具,这有助于直接面向对性能影响最大的位置进行调整。
兼容性
POSIX* 线程
支持 OpenMP*
英特尔? 线程构建模块
英特尔? Fortran 和 C++ 编译器
GNU C++ 编译器 Linux 版
技术支持
借助英特尔? 线程检查器 3.1 Linux 版,您将获得 Intel? Premier Support 提供的为期一年的技术支持和产品更新服务,还可使用我们的交互式问题管理与交流网站。通过 Intel? Premier Support 服务,您可提交问题和下载产品更新,还可获得技术说明、应用说明及其他文档。

系统要求

x86 架构系统的系统要求

安腾 2 架构系统的系统要求

超线程技术要求计算机系统具备:支持超线程(HT)技术的英特尔? 奔腾? 4 处理器,以及支持超线程(HT)技术的芯片组、BIOS 和操作系统。实际性能会因您具体使用的硬件和软件的不同而有所差异。

发表评论
用户名: 密码: 会员注册
评 论:
重点推荐
特约经销商
  • 北京市
    +86(10)85298800
促销
测评
新闻
案例
技术